Anaerobic respiration

Anaerobic respiration is respiration using electron acceptors other than molecular oxygen (O2) in its electron transport chain.

In aerobic organisms, electrons are shuttled to an electron transport chain, and the final electron acceptor is oxygen. Molecular oxygen is an excellent electron acceptor. Anaerobes instead use less-oxidizing (in either thermodynamic or kinetics sense) substances such as nitrate (NO
